About Hornet Cutting Systems

Hornet Cutting Systems designs, manufactures, and distributes CNC-controlled oxy-fuel, plasma, and waterjet cutting machines out of its Valley Center, KS facility. The company started in 2004 and has become one of the of the leading plasma cutting machine OEMs in North American through innovation and its customer-centric business model. Hornet Cutting Systems has experienced very steady growth of its deployed equipment base over the last 17 years.

Primary Purpose of Job

The role is primarily responsible for overseeing and driving the machine-building process from start to finish, creating the master production schedule, then fabrication, machining, assembly, engineering, and quality departments work in coordination and have the resources (manpower, raw materials, parts, and equipment) they require to deliver machines on or before scheduled completion date at the lowest possible cost to the Company. The goal of the position is to improve production efficiencies, team focus, and stats while reducing total costs. Accountabilities

  • Leads the production department’s leads and employees.
  • Manages shop leads and employees and shop resources to ensure strict Master Production Schedule adherence.
  • Holds shop leads and employees accountable to their role(s) in strict master production schedule adherence and getting machines out the door on time.
  • Creates, updates, and ensures real-time accuracy ofthe master production schedule using the Company’s MRP software.
  • Is present on the floor during daily production hours and mandatory overtime hours, when assigned, to ensure the schedule is being adhered to by leads and employees and that any changes that come up are immediately reflected in the master production schedule.
  • Collaborates with engineering, purchasing, quality, fabrication, machining, and assembly leads to stay abreast of constantly changing needs to ensure each department has what it needs to stay on or ahead of the master production schedule.

Elements of the Role

  • Monitors and evaluates each work center in the manufacturing process to ensure maximum labor and material efficiency.
  • Uses inputs from engineering, sales, and operations to built accurate, realistic, and practical schedules for machine builds.
  • Proactively plans and implements actions to assure on-time product delivery; manage lead times to internal and external customer expectations.
  • Plan and release production builds/batches.
  • Plans, schedules, and directs rework builds.
  • Provides clear and impeccable over-the-phone communication with customers and internal employees.
  • Inspects products prior to shipment to ensure they adhere to customer specifications and required recordkeeping.
  • Ensures work is performed/managed in accordance with the Company’s (and outside) quality system(s), also ensuring that each employee is tested and signed off on as proficient in the processes they complete with record of training/proficiency on file.
  • Encourages, fosters, and maintains open lines of communication between employees and management by being available to field questions and by providing consistent, real-time help, feedback, correction, training, and coaching.
  • Establishes training methods for the fabrication and welder personnel, ie; blueprint reading, layout, fabrication and welding, press brake, folding machine, saw, paint gun/booth, etc.
  • Evaluates and allocates resources to efficiently relieve bottlenecks within manufacturing flow as required.
  • Leads the daily production huddle.
  • Interfaces as needed with customers served by the warehouse to maintain productive business relationships with key end-users.
  • Makes recommendations to guide and direct shop personnel in the completion of tasks assigned within time limits of project schedule requirements.
  • Any other duties deemed necessary or assigned by management
